  11. I second this. I started from home and now have a small ( 15 Car ) unit with 2 offices and a small kitchen. My overheads are relatively low compared to flashy showrooms but its still a huge cost. Rates ( if applicable ) waste collection, water, electricity, insurance, alarm, cctv, Planning etc..... All ads up. But working from a unit sure beats working from home and having people sat in your dining room. If it works for you, go for it. Logistics are key. You'll always get a call on the one you've not cleaned thats at home and you'll be p1ssing around moving stuff re cleaning etc.. all part of the fun. The unit definitely gives us a more professional appearance than when doing from home ( also stopped the nosey neighbours peering over the fence ) Good luck though whichever way you decide

  24. Hi Matt, Correct me if i'm wrong but i'm sure you need Sui Generis Planning to run a car sales operation. We don't fall under A1 Retail i'm pretty sure. Luckily my unit had this application already granted. None of the council run business parks in my city accept car sales from a one of their units either. http://www.gilmartinley.co.uk/resources/planning-uses I got lucky and bagged the second one I looked at.
